(Photo by Watal Asanuma/Shinko Music/Getty Images) On June 20, 1945, Morna Anne Murray was born in the rural coal mining town of Springhill, Nova Scotia, Canada. Today she celebrates her 81st birthday with four Grammys, three CMA Awards, and more than 55 million records sold under her belt. Without Murray’s love for music, we may never have witness…
